A scary moment occurred at the Winnipeg Jets practice Friday.
Star defenceman Dustin Byfuglien took a shot that hit forward Blake Wheeler in the head.

Wheeler hit the ice and spent a few minutes down, writhing in pain. He did, however, get up on his own power and left the ice with a towel on his face.
Coach Paul Maurice told reporters that Wheeler was coherent, but the player’s health status won’t be known until he is examined by medical staff. An update is expected Saturday.
The 29-year-old Wheeler is enjoying a stellar season, scoring a team-high 21 points through 20 games and limiting his penalties to just six minutes.
The Jets next host the Arizona Coyotes Saturday in Winnipeg.
